The objective of the BlackRock Income Trust managed fund is The Fund aims to outperform peer performance consistent with a 'growth' orientated investment strategy encompassing: ? a broadly diversified exposure to Australian and international assets; ? active asset allocation; security selection and risk management; and ? flexibility to deviate meaningfully from the strategic asset allocation to help manage total portfolio risk.
The strategy of the BlackRock Income Trust managed fund is The investment strategy of the Fund is to provide investors with a diversified exposure to the best investment teams and strategies that the BlackRock Group has globally within the context of an Australian based 'growth' investment portfolio. The Fund's strategy is built around two steps: ? establishing the most appropriate strategic benchmark subject to the growth/income splits and market risk exposures of the Fund.
